Ingredients
200g of berries (strawberries, raspberries, blueberries)
The juice and zest of half a lemon
4 yolks
100 ml of sweet champagne
85 grams of sugar
Step by step recipe
Step 1
Peel the berries. Cut the large strawberries into 2 to 4 pieces. Drizzle with lemon juice and sprinkle with 1 tsp. sugar. Stir gently and place in the refrigerator.
Step 2

Prepare a water bath: boil so much water in a large saucepan that the bottom (preferably round) of a steel bowl will not reach it. Grate lemon zest on a fine grater. Set the bowl in the saucepan. Put the zest, sugar, and yolks in the bowl and start beating with a whisk.
Step 3.

When the mass has lightened and increased in volume, pour in the champagne a little at a time, without stopping to whisk. Spread the dessert in a crème de la crème and garnish with the berries. Serve the sabayon as soon as it is ready, warm.
A tip
An excellent accompaniment to the sabayon is a thin shortbread cookie “Cat’s tongues” or a piece of muffin.
